Levels (Meek Mill song)
2013 single by Meek Mill From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
"Levels" is a song by American rapper Meek Mill, released on July 2, 2013 as the lead single from the Maybach Music Group compilation album, Self Made Vol. 3. The song has since peaked at number 15 on the US Billboard Bubbling Under Hot 100 Singles chart.

Reception
Rob Markman from MTV noted the song's personal content, describing it as what "is focused on upward mobility," and claimed that "Meek thumbs his nose at lower-tier rappers."[2]
Music video
The music video premiered on August 13, 2013, on WorldStarHipHop and was directed by Hype Williams. Fellow American rappers T.I., Rick Ross and Big Sean appear in the video, along with DJ Drama.[3][4]
